Choosing the Right Trench Drain for Your Property
When considering a custom trench drain and dry well installation in Portland, OR, selecting the right solution for your property is paramount. The first step involves understanding the unique needs of your landscape. French drains, for instance, are an excellent choice for properties with flat or slightly sloped yards, offering effective water management by redirecting it away from foundations and towards drainage systems. These drains are designed to handle high volumes of water, making them ideal for areas prone to heavy rainfall.
Factors like soil composition, existing drainage patterns, and the location of underground utilities should guide your decision. Consulting with a professional installer in Portland, OR, is crucial to ensure compatibility with your property’s topography and infrastructure. They can recommend the most suitable trench drain system, be it a traditional French drain or an alternative design, ensuring optimal water flow and preventing potential damage from excess moisture.
Dry Well Installation: A Step-by-Step Guide
Installing a dry well, a crucial component in Portland, OR, French drain systems, involves several precise steps to ensure effective water management. Here’s a simplified guide:
1. Site Preparation: Begin by clearing and preparing the area where the dry well will be located. Ensure it’s accessible for materials and equipment. Dig a hole that conforms to the dry well’s dimensions, typically around 3-4 feet deep and wide enough to accommodate the structure.
2. Install the Dry Well Structure: Position the dry well at the lowest point of your drainage area, ensuring proper slope away from buildings. Place it firmly in the hole, backfill with gravel or stone, leaving a small gap for future inspections. Connect the inlet pipe from the trench drain system to the dry well using appropriate fittings.

Maintaining Your New French Drain System in Portland
After successfully installing your new custom trench drain and dry well system in Portland, OR, proper maintenance is key to ensure its longevity and optimal performance. Regular cleaning and inspection are essential components of French drain care. Clogging can be a significant issue, so it’s important to clear debris like leaves, twigs, and other organic material from the drain’s surface and surrounding area. A simple periodic sweeping or hosing down can prevent buildup.
Additionally, checking for any signs of damage or leaks is crucial. Inspecting the drainage system visually and listening for unusual noises can help identify potential problems early on. Promptly addressing any maintenance needs will not only maintain the efficiency of your Portland OR French Drain Installation but also prevent more costly repairs in the future.
